**CI note: timezone weirdness in report exports**

Heads up, support folks — if a customer says their Ledgerpine export shows times shifted by a few hours, it's probably the CI image. The export workers got rebuilt last week and the base image defaults to UTC, while older workers used the account's locale. Fix is rolling out; meanwhile tell customers the data itself is fine, just the display offset. Affected exports carry the build token shown below.

build token for bajof-tahop: htk4_a981

## Undo/Redo in Sketchfen

Sketchfen's diagram editor keeps an append-only command log per document; undo and redo replay inverse operations rather than snapshots. The log is signed at save time so tampering is detectable during review. For your audit environment, you'll need to verify signed logs locally. The verification counterpart pairs with the deploy key provided below.

release key, fajef-kajeg: bky19_LdLu6Ne6FLi8he2c24d

# Regional Sales Review — Managers Only

Norvale region: Q2 closed 4% under plan. Kessway branch carried the quarter; Dunmoor lagged on pipeline conversion. Actions: tighten forecast hygiene, weekly deal reviews through quarter end, freeze non-essential travel. Full figures in the restricted folder. Do not share outside this group. Context for these moves follows in the note below.

management briefing: Project Ulavan slips by two quarters because of the staffing delay.

Quick heads-up before Thursday's review: we're switching logistics providers from Calloway Freight to Bryndel Transport at the end of the quarter. Short version — better coverage in the northern corridors, tracking that actually works, and a modest saving per consignment. Expect a bumpy fortnight during cutover, so pad your delivery promises accordingly and warn key accounts early. Don't announce anything externally until the transition plan is signed off. The confidential commercial rationale follows directly below.

management briefing: The renewal with Zoraelax Group closes at $10 million a year, 15 percent below the last contract. Project Ralael slips by six weeks because of the audit delay.